G force T5 hadles the same power as TKO 600 A grand cheaper.
Over kill for 400 HP. But sure as hell be nice to have.
what's your recommondation?
or a G force kit to put in a second hand T5 kit is $1300
Yella terra fly wheel $300
hard core clutch from Sunbury clutch and brake off Ebay think I payed $350 for mine.
Bellhousing kit from CRS or Dellow around the $550 with X member.
By my time sheet at the drags I have 420 HP and use a standard T5, if treated ok a standard T5 would be up to the job. Any where from $100 to $450
Under dash pedal unit ? X member $225 what the.
If the money is there to spend the TKO and bellhousing would be ok but the price for some of the other stuff is a bit steep.
